Handover for review: Merrow to Tas. Swapped the per-request tax-rate lookups in Tollbridge for a shared cache with TTL-based invalidation. Review focus: eviction logic and the fallback path when the rate source is unreachable. Tests cover both. No schema changes. Cache behavior is driven entirely by the service config, reproduced below for reference.

config for kagup-hahig:
druwyn:
  pin: 2801
  metrics_host: metrics.druwyn.zemvarlabs.internal
  tenant: sorius
  seal: seal_798a43d7

The Fenholt inventory reconciliation job runs hourly, comparing warehouse counts from the Drossel feed against the ledger service. Relevant variables: RECON_BATCH_SIZE (default 500), RECON_DRY_RUN (must be false in prod), and RECON_REGION. Reviewers should confirm dry-run is off only after the ledger snapshot check passes. The job authenticates to the Drossel feed with a key stored in .env.recon, on the line that follows this paragraph.

vault entry, yahif-yajep: COURIER_KEY29=b802bdf8034096b65a51c6ba5abe2

So, cold starts. When a Fenwick handler hasn't been hit in ~10 minutes, the runtime spins up fresh and re-reads the whole env file — that's why a bad variable only bites intermittently and support tickets look flaky. `WARMKEEP_INTERVAL` controls the keep-alive pinger; set it to 0 to disable (don't, on the checkout handlers). `INIT_TIMEOUT_MS` caps startup work; raise it before blaming the platform. During init the handler also fetches config from the Larkspur vault, and the vault credential goes on the very next line.

sealed setting: RELAY_SECRET5=82864